Lankford’s amendment to rescind the COVID-19 vaccine mandate appears in Section 525 (page 407) of the FY23 NDAA.

RESCISSION OF COVID-19 VACCINATION MANDATE. Not later than 30 days after the date of the enactment of this Act, the Secretary of Defense shall rescind the mandate that members of the Armed Forces be vaccinated against COVID-19 pursuant to the memorandum dated August 24, 2021, regarding ‘‘Mandatory Coronavirus Disease 2019 Vaccination of Department of Defense Service Members’’.
